beging直播APP百科

您现在的位置是:首页 > 分析免费版安卓版 > 正文

分析免费版安卓版

more命令-探索Linux终端神器:更好用的more命令

admin2024-04-20分析免费版安卓版5
more命令是Linux终端的一个常用工具,用于浏览文本文件。它可以让你方便、快捷地查看大量的文本内容,能够自动按照屏幕大小分页显示内容,同时提供多种操作方式,使得用户能够灵活控制浏览进度。下面将对m

more命令是Linux终端的一个常用工具,用于浏览文本文件。它可以让你方便、快捷地查看大量的文本内容,能够自动按照屏幕大小分页显示内容,同时提供多种操作方式,使得用户能够灵活控制浏览进度。下面将对more命令的使用进行详细介绍,帮助大家更好地了解和使用这个终端神器。

基础用法

more命令基础用法非常简单,只需要在终端中输入more加上要浏览的文件名,就可以开始查看文件内容了。当文本内容超过屏幕一页时,more命令会自动停止,等待用户输入命令来继续查看。

例如,我们要查看一个名为example.txt的文本文件的内容,可以在终端中输入以下命令:

more example.txt

在开始浏览之后,可以使用以下命令控制浏览进度:

Enter键:向下翻一页。

空格键:向下翻一页。

b键:向上翻一页。

q键:退出浏览。

另外,more命令还支持在命令行中指定页数,例如我们想要在屏幕中显示2页文本内容,可以在终端中输入以下命令:

more -2 example.txt

更高级的用法

显示行号

默认情况下,more命令不会显示行号。但是,如果你需要用到行号,可以使用命令行参数来启用它。例如,我们想要在文本内容前面显示行号,可以在终端中输入以下命令:

more -n example.txt

在这个命令中,-n参数表示启用行号。之后我们就可以在文本内容前面看到行数了。

搜索文本

more命令还支持搜索文本功能。我们可以在命令行中指定要搜索的内容,more命令会自动将搜索到的内容高亮显示。

more命令-探索Linux终端神器:更好用的more命令

例如,我们想要搜索一个名为example.txt的文件中的test字符串,可以在终端中输入以下命令:

more example.txt | grep -w test

结果中,搜索到的内容会以突出显示的方式呈现出来。这个命令中的“|”是管道符,它将more命令的标准输出传递给grep命令。-w参数表示只匹配整个单词,不匹配部分单词。

使用less命令代替more命令

实际上,有些Linux发行版默认使用less而不是more。less命令与more命令类似,也可以用于浏览文本文件。与more命令不同的是,less命令支持更多的功能和更灵活的操作方式。如果你想要用less命令代替more命令,可以在终端中输入以下命令:

alias more=less

这个命令会在当前终端中将more命令的别名设置为less命令,从而实现功能替换。

结论

more命令是Linux终端中非常实用的工具之一。它可以帮助我们快速浏览大量文本内容,还支持各种实用的功能,例如显示行号、搜索文本等等。如果你想要更好地使用more命令,可以多参考相关的资料和文档,通过不断练习和实践,进一步提高自己的终端技能。